Street Simit — Frequently Asked Questions

How many calories are in street simit, and what are its macros?

Street simit provides 340 calories per 100 g. Per 100 g, it also contains 9.5 g protein, 63 g carbs, 6.5 g fat, and 3.5 g fiber.

Is street simit high glycemic, and who can eat it?

Street simit has a glycemic index of 70, which is considered high. It fits omnivore, vegetarian, Mediterranean, and flexitarian diets, and it contains gluten and sesame.
